const { checkLogin } = require("../util-server");
const { UptimeCalculator } = require("../uptime-calculator");
const { log } = require("../../src/util");
const dayjs = require("dayjs");
module.exports.chartSocketHandler = (socket) => {
socket.on("getMonitorChartData", async (monitorID, period, callback) => {
try {
checkLogin(socket);
log.debug("monitor", `Get Monitor Chart Data: ${monitorID} User ID: ${socket.userID}`);
if (period == null) {
throw new Error("Invalid period.");
}
let uptimeCalculator = await UptimeCalculator.getUptimeCalculator(monitorID);
let data;
if (period <= 24) {
data = uptimeCalculator.getDataArray(period * 60, "minute");
} else if (period <= 720) {
data = uptimeCalculator.getDataArray(period, "hour");
} else {
data = uptimeCalculator.getDataArray(period / 24, "day");
}
callback({
ok: true,
data,
});
} catch (e) {
callback({
ok: false,
msg: e.message,
});
}
});
socket.on("getMonitorNumericHistory", async (monitorID, period, callback) => {
try {
checkLogin(socket);
log.debug("monitor", `Get Monitor Numeric History: ${monitorID} User ID: ${socket.userID}`);
if (period == null) {
throw new Error("Invalid period.");
}
let uptimeCalculator = await UptimeCalculator.getUptimeCalculator(monitorID);
const periodHours = parseInt(period);
let dataArray;
if (periodHours <= 24) {
dataArray = uptimeCalculator.getDataArray(periodHours * 60, "minute");
} else if (periodHours <= 720) {
dataArray = uptimeCalculator.getDataArray(periodHours, "hour");
} else {
dataArray = uptimeCalculator.getDataArray(periodHours / 24, "day");
}
// Filter and convert to format expected by frontend
// Only include entries with numeric values
// Use numeric_value as the main value, with min/max for reference
const data = dataArray
.filter((entry) => entry.avgNumeric !== null && entry.avgNumeric !== undefined)
.map((entry) => ({
value: parseFloat(entry.avgNumeric),
min:
entry.minNumeric !== null && entry.minNumeric !== undefined
? parseFloat(entry.minNumeric)
: null,
max:
entry.maxNumeric !== null && entry.maxNumeric !== undefined
? parseFloat(entry.maxNumeric)
: null,
timestamp: entry.timestamp,
time: dayjs.unix(entry.timestamp).utc().format("YYYY-MM-DD HH:mm:ss"),
}));
callback({
ok: true,
data,
});
} catch (e) {
callback({
ok: false,
msg: e.message,
});
}
});
};
